oracle 数据迁移导入 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-10-24 05:20 39
Oracle 数据迁移导入的适用场景 在企业中,数据迁移导入是一个常见的操作,特别是当企业需要将旧系统的数据迁移到新系统时。这个过程涉及到将数据库中的数据从一个系统迁移到另一个系统的过程,并确保数据的完整性和准确性。以下是一些适用场景的例子: 1. 公司希望将其旧系统中的数据迁移到新系统,以提高运营效率和数据管理能力。 2. 公司计划将数据从一个数据库服务器迁移到另一个数据库服务器,以提高性能和可扩展性。 3. 公司在合并或收购后需要将不同系统中的数据整合到一个统一的数据库中。
相关原因 进行数据迁移导入的一些常见原因包括: 1. 系统升级:公司决定将旧系统升级到新版本,以获得更多功能和更好的性能。 2. 业务扩展:公司由于业务的扩展需要更大的数据处理能力,因此需要将数据迁移到更强大的系统中。 3. 数据整合:公司可能在合并或收购后需要将不同系统中的数据整合到一个数据库中,以提供统一的数据视图。
解决方案 进行数据迁移导入时,可以采用以下解决方案: 1. 数据备份和恢复:在进行数据迁移之前,首先需要对旧系统中的数据进行备份。一旦迁移过程出现问题,可以通过备份数据进行恢复。 2. 数据转换和映射:在将数据从旧系统迁移到新系统时,可能需要进行数据转换和映射。这可以确保数据在新系统中的结构和格式是正确的。 3. 数据验证和:在完成数据迁移后,需要对迁移后的数据进行验证和,以确保数据的准确性和完整性。
处理流程 数据库数据迁移导入的一般处理流程包括以下步骤: 1. 分析:需要对旧系统中的数据进行分析,确定需要迁移的数据类型和范围。 2. 准备:在进行数据迁移之前,需要准备好目标数据库和迁移工具,并进行相应的配置。 3. 导出:将旧系统中的数据导出为一个或多个文件,以备将来导入到新系统中。 4. 转换:如果需要进行数据转换和映射,可以在此步骤中进行。 5. 导入:将导出的数据文件导入到新系统中的目标数据库中。 6. 验证和:在完成数据导入后,需要对迁移后的数据进行验证和,以确保数据的准确性和完整性。 7. 完成:一旦数据迁移导入成功,并通过验证和,可以宣布迁移工作完成。
技术人员要求 进行数据库数据迁移导入需要一定的技术知识和经验。以下是一些技术人员应具备的要求: 1. 数据库管理经验:技术人员应该对数据库有一定的管理经验,熟悉数据库的结构、配置和运维。 2. 数据迁移工具使用:技术人员应该熟悉使用数据库迁移工具,如Oracle Data Pump等。 3. 数据转换和映射:如果需要进行数据转换和映射,技术人员应该熟悉相关的转换和映射技术。 4. 故障排除和恢复:在进行数据迁移导入过程中,可能会遇到各种问题和故障,技术人员应该有能力进行故障排除和数据恢复。
注意事项和容易出错的地方 在进行数据库数据迁移导入时,需要注意以下事项和容易出错的地方: 1. 数据备份:在进行数据迁移之前,务必进行数据备份,以防止数据丢失或损坏。 2. 数据完整性:在进行数据迁移时,需要确保数据的完整性。这包括检查数据的完整性约束、外键约束和唯一性约束。 3. 数据转换和映射:如果需要进行数据转换和映射,需要确保转换和映射的准确性,以避免导入错误的数据。 4. 导入顺序:如果需要导入多个数据文件,需要确保按照正确的顺序进行导入,以保持数据的关联性和一致性。 5. 监控和日志:在进行数据迁移导入期间,需要进行实时监控和记录日志,以便及时发现和解决问题。
相关FAQ问答: 1. 是否可以在生产环境中进行数据迁移导入? 答:可以进行数据迁移导入,但需要特别小心和谨慎,务必进行数据备份,并在非高峰期进行操作。 2. 是否需要停止生产系统进行数据迁移导入? 答:不一定需要停止生产系统,可以选择在系统负载较低的时候进行数据迁移导入。 3. 是否可以只迁移部分数据而不是全部? 答:可以只迁移部分数据,根据需求选择需要迁移的数据范围。 4. 是否可以同时进行数据迁移和系统升级? 答:可以同时进行数据迁移和系统升级,但需要谨慎计划和,以确保数据的完整性和系统的稳定性。 5. 是否可以回滚数据迁移导入过程? 答:在进行数据迁移导入之前,务必进行备份,并确保能够回滚数据迁移导入过程。